The Lightguard Weapon Light by Crimson Trace is a high-performance tactical accessory designed for the Ruger LCP II. It features a powerful 110 Lumen LED light with both Constant-On and Momentary modes, ensuring versatility in any situation. With ambidextrous controls for instant activation and a runtime of over an hour, this light is perfect for tactical carry, concealed carry, and competition use. Its user-friendly design requires no gunsmithing, making it an essential addition for any firearm enthusiast.

Great light
This is a great weapon light for the LCP II .380 and the price is right, too. Not as bright as a TLR6 but it will do the job in a dark room, take it to the bank.You can use the stock Ruger Pocket holster that ships with the gun with this light. You just need to remove the retention stitching in the middle of the holster that would hold it firm stock; and then add a few stitches to the edges of the holster to retain behind the triggerguard to pinch the holster together. See the photo I attached. Blue is the stitching that needs to be removed; red is the stitching that needs to be added. Great product, BUT, the button press is so easy, it drains the battery in a soft sided holster
This product works great! The only drawback I have, after having it for more than a year, is that I have to have a hard sided holster, like Sneaky Pete's, or the button press on the side pushes by accident in a soft sided holster, draining the battery.
